Balasore: A newlywed woman was found hanging from ceiling at a rented house in Balasore town of Odisha on Tuesday.

The deceased was identified as Rashmiprava Sahoo, the wife of Uday Kumar Sahoo, a junior scientist working with DRDO at Chandipur.

However, the cause behind suicide is yet to be clear.

According to reports, the newlywed couple was staying in a rented house near Fakir Mohan College road under Town Police limits in Balasore district. Rashmiprava took the extreme step by hanging herself with a rope in absence of her husband at home on Tuesday.

The DRDO scientist later took her wife to the hospital where she was declared dead.

As there was no complaint filed at police station, police handed over the body to the family after registering an 'unnatural death' case following postmortem.

Reports said that Uday Sahoo is a native of Pitambarpur area under Paradeep Lock police limits in Jagatsinghpur district. He had tied the knot with Rashmiprava, the daughter of Rabinarayan Sahoo, a resident of Sailo village under Tirtol police limits in the same district, on May 7.
